Got a new, unlocked, Galazy S7 last month when my old phone was stolen. As soon as I activated it, I made sure wi-fi assist was off, turned on mobile data saver, connected to my normal wifi places (school, work, home, family's house), and tweaked various settings to make sure I wouldn't leak any data. My phone usage habits have remained exactly the same. However, Verizon said my data use skyrocketed, that I went over my data limits, and I got charged for two extra gigs. This month I thought to check how my phone measures data- it showed normal use and that I was WELL within my limits. I don't expect my phone and Verizon to be exactly the same, but they are off by a factor of ten. Furthermore, this entire week I have had mobile data turned off and disabled so many apps and functions that my phone is practically a brick. Verizon is STILL showing extremely high data use.
Has anyone else had this problem? Does anyone know what's going on?
